首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将axios数据传递给视图模板

是指在前端开发中,通过使用axios库发送HTTP请求获取数据,并将这些数据传递给视图模板进行展示。

axios是一个基于Promise的HTTP客户端,可以在浏览器和Node.js中发送异步请求。它支持各种请求方法,如GET、POST等,并提供了丰富的配置选项和拦截器,使得数据的获取和处理更加灵活和方便。

在前端开发中,我们可以使用axios发送HTTP请求获取后端接口返回的数据。一般情况下,我们会将获取到的数据存储在前端的变量中,然后将这些数据传递给视图模板进行展示。

具体的步骤如下:

  1. 在前端项目中引入axios库,可以通过CDN引入或者使用npm安装。
  2. 使用axios发送HTTP请求,可以通过axios.get()、axios.post()等方法发送不同类型的请求,并传递相应的URL和参数。
  3. 在请求的回调函数中,可以通过response对象获取到后端返回的数据。可以使用response.data来访问数据。
  4. 将获取到的数据存储在前端的变量中,可以使用Vue.js、React等前端框架进行数据绑定,或者直接使用JavaScript进行操作。
  5. 将存储在前端变量中的数据传递给视图模板进行展示,可以使用模板引擎(如Handlebars、EJS等)或者前端框架的组件进行渲染。

这样,通过axios将数据传递给视图模板,可以实现前后端数据的交互和展示。在实际应用中,可以根据具体的业务需求和前端框架的特点,选择合适的方式进行数据传递和展示。

腾讯云相关产品推荐:

  • 云服务器(CVM):提供弹性计算能力,可满足不同规模和需求的业务场景。详情请参考:云服务器产品介绍
  • 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务,适用于各种在线应用场景。详情请参考:云数据库MySQL版产品介绍
  • 云存储(COS):提供安全、稳定、低成本的对象存储服务,适用于图片、音视频、文档等各种文件的存储和管理。详情请参考:云存储产品介绍
  • 人工智能机器翻译(TMT):提供高质量、多语种的机器翻译服务,可应用于文本翻译、语音翻译等场景。详情请参考:人工智能机器翻译产品介绍
  • 物联网通信(IoT):提供稳定、安全的物联网通信服务,可连接和管理大规模的物联网设备。详情请参考:物联网通信产品介绍
  • 区块链服务(BCS):提供一站式区块链解决方案,可满足不同行业的区块链应用需求。详情请参考:区块链服务产品介绍

以上是腾讯云提供的一些相关产品,可以根据具体需求选择合适的产品进行使用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券